Listeria Headcheese Confirmed; Cantaloupe Outbreak Ends — May 15, 2026
from Food Recall Watch · host Food Recall Watch — Lantern Podcasts
Illinois’ Daisy Brand headcheese alert sharpened into a confirmed Listeria outbreak source, while CDC closed a 25-state Salmonella cantaloupe outbreak. Whole Foods shoppers also get a peanut-allergen recall for Fly By Jing creamy sesame noodles. In this episode: Top stories: 1.
